2024 Flag Football Week 6: Classical and Mira Mesa Still On Top

Floating at state No. 3, Classical (16-4) hoped for repeat success over #2 Newport Harbor (19-2), but the Sailors battened the hatches for a 37-0 win. The Caimans had keelhauled the seafaring club, 26-13, as well as #4 San Juan Capistrano JSerra (17-5) and #6 Huntington Beach (17-7) earlier this season.

Mira Mesa (11-2) bobbed at local #2, with a 47-0 win over Hoover (5-9). The next best all rose in the state rankings, as Brawley (11-6) and Torrey Pines (10-7) soared 18 and 16 spots, respectively.

Among the coverage-neglected, modest enrollment schools,  Santa Fe Christian (3-1), Tri-City (5-1), Francis Parker (3-1), and Escondido Charter (6-1) stand out, rated state 136, 165, 228 and 256, respectively, by MaxPreps. Tri-City  bowled over now one-loss Escondido Charter, 33-7, and bested larger Vista (2-7) and Canyon Crest (3-6).

2024 Flag Football Week 5: Classical Slips But No Fall

State No. 3 Classical (13-3) slipped two notches by losing to #11 Corona del Mar (13-5) and #18 Huntington Beach (13-6), but crept back up by thumping #20 Mira Mesa, 41-0. The Caimans are outscoring opponents 553-259, led by sophomore QB Ella Moore, who has  passed for  70 touchdowns. Moore has a 71% completion rate and is on pace for 4,000 yards for the season.

Mira Mesa (10-2) and La Costa (7-1) have improved from middling 9-7 and 7-4 seasons, respectively, in 2023 to gain Top 10 spots.  Otay Ranch (5-0) has improved from 4-7, and Our Lady of Peace (9-1) shows consistency with its 8-1 season of 2023. Bonita Vista (7-4), the 2023 Division I champ, has skidded  from a 19-1 record.

Of the 26 new teams, San Marcos (9-1), Poway (8-1), Rancho Buena Vista (7-2), and Westview (7-2) programs are showing the way.

2024 Flag Football Week 4: Classical Shares National Top Ranking

State No. 2 Classical (12-1) bested then No. 3 San Juan Capistrano JSerra (10-3), 28-13. The Caimans’ and No. 1 Orange Lutheran (15-0) also are numbers 1 and  2 nationally, according to Max Preps.

Classical next faces Mira Mesa (9-1), whose lone loss was to a strong Our Lady of Peace (6-1) squad.

Grossmont jumped up to local #2, based on besting last year’s D-I champion Bonita Vista (5-3), and a 7-6 win over previously undefeated 6-1 Chula Vista Learning (minimum 5 games).

The anticipated ‘scoring juggernauts’ game Poway (7-1) vs. San Marcos (7-1) was a dud, as San Marcos won 8-6. Both had previously outscored their opponents by an average of over 20 points. Poway then squeaked by 5-2 Westview, 21-20.

Other successful efforts were by  La Costa Canyon (6-1), San Marcos (7-1), Santana (6-1-1), and Calexico Vincent Memorial (4-1).

2024 Flag Football Week 3: Caimans Feast on Barons

State No. 2 Classical (10-1) handled Bonita Vista (4-2), 43-6, and next week faces No. 3 San Juan Capistrano JSerra. The Caimans’ lone loss was to state and national No. 1 Orange Lutheran (13-0), 40-14. Classical is averaging 39 points a game and has outscored opponents, 433-172.

Mira Mesa (7-1) squeaked by Torrey Pines, 9-8, to move up in the ranks, along with newcomers Grossmont (3-1), Westview (5-0) and Our Lady of Peace (5-1).

This week’s featured game is Poway (6-0), a scoring machine at 180-32 points overall,  at San Marcos (6-0), a 212-46 juggernaut.

2024 Flag Football Week 1: Bonita Vista, Classical Have 2023 Look

Defending San Diego Section champions are off to a strong start, each with a majority of their All-CIF starters returning.

Division I Bonita Vista (3-0), coming off a 19-1 season, is outscoring its opponents 533 to 137. This early season includes a win over Brawley (6-2), itself a five-game winner in a one-day tournament!

D-II Classical  (6-1), rated No. 4 in the state by Max Preps, overpowered Mission Viejo, Number 13 Newport Harbor, and 26 Long Beach Poly, losing only to #2  San Juan Capistrano JSerra.  Last season the Caimans were 17-2 and led the section in scoring at 30 points a game, outscoring opponents 573 to 86.

A local “Clash of the Titans” is Sept. 7, when Classical hosts Bonita Vista. Schedules and results are here.

D-I newcomer Poway (4-0, #36)  dominated its 4 opponents with a 114-20 scoring  total, as only Santana (4-1-1) put up a fight, 20-12. The lady Titans will meet Bonita Vista on Sept. 21.

In town notables are Mira Mesa (4-1), Mission Bay (4-2), plus Kearny (3-0), with all shutout wins and outscoring opponents 75-0.

Brawley (6-2), Imperial (4-1), and Calexico Vincent Memorial (3-0) are off to a good starts in the desert.
